Chisonni

Outside of National variants there is only really 2 places where XL isnt paired with Bennett. 1. Sukokomon - XL will usually run Fav Lance and a mega ton of ER, Kokomi will usually run TTDS to buff XL, the primariy damage of the team still comes from Sucrose doing a hotpot of reactions by swirling the elements applied from Gubao, Oz and Jellyfish. 2. Hu Tao Double Hydro - an unorthodox option, but the Hydro application from XQ + Yelan is good enough to support both Hu Tao and XL on the same team. Hu Tao provides Pyro Res shred and Pyro DMG bonus (C6) as well as a minimal bonus from Pyro resonance. Even with Fav and ER stacking she likely wont be able to burst every single rotation but you can hold her burst for vulnerability phases. The Nation of Pyro Natlan is still coming in the future. Therefore I wouldnt expect to see any Pyro characters anymore until we actually get there. Natlan will have the Pyro archon guaranteed and I would be surprised if we didnt get 2-3 new Pyro supports along the way. Bennett being who he is really makes it difficult to design a character ( even a 5star) that would be able to provide a stronger buff, since the combination of Bennett + (super 5star support) + Pyro + Kazuha would make for an insanely strong team, proven by the fact that MonoPyro is the strongest single element team already. See even with Shenhe, MonoFreeze never really picked up because Freeze despite dealing no damage just provides more comfort, safety and enables 4p Blizzard Strayer which is a larger DPS increase than running 3x Cryo + Kazuha.

Chisonni

HP is for healing, EM is for dmg. My Kuki with full EM/EM/EM and Ironsting as her weapon still heals for about 2.4k per tick which is more than enough to heal through all chip damage. The sword would be a decent in-between option if for whatever reason you need more healing it probably adds maybe an extra 500 HP / tick? While still giving 120 EM so you dont lose as much, but for Hyperbloom especially max EM == max DMG so you wouldnt use it. In Aggravat/Spread you can still build Kuki for max EM which allows her own Aggravate to deal more damage than any HP build would do, but since she isnt the primary DPS of the team you can also give up more EM to get better healing.

TheTechHobbit

Yes, all versions are capped at 60fps maximum except for iOS due to a special deal with Apple. A 144hz monitor won't improve anything, FPS is dependent on your system hardware (in this case the PS5). A high refresh rate monitor just allows you to actually see the higher frame rate if you're playing something at that rate.

random_redditerer

Two questions: For Sucrose's burst, does she apply the absorbed element or anemo first? Can swirl trigger amplifying/additive reactions (vape, aggravate) to increase damage?


leRedd1

> For Sucrose's burst, does she apply the absorbed element or anemo first? This is interesting and a bit tricky to test, see [KQM TCL](https://library.keqingmains.com/evidence/characters/anemo/sucrose) for explanation. > Can swirl trigger amplifying/additive reactions (vape, aggravate) to increase damage? Yep. See section on [Swirl/Burning-Induced Reaction Damage from wiki](https://genshin-impact.fandom.com/wiki/Damage). It's basically amplifying/additive reactions damage with all crit dependence removed, but EM (and character level for additive case) dependence still present.
